Programmieren - alles kontrollieren 4.935 Themen, 20.621 Beiträge

Hilfe bei QC2 - C-Compiler

Nobody666 / 1 Antworten / Flachansicht Nickles

Hallo zusammen,


kann mir jemand sagen, wie ich in QC2 Pfadangaben setze? Mit dem GCC funktioniert es einfach mit d:\\test\\abc.dat


ich möchte ín meinem Programm eine Datei öffnen, die nicht in meinem aufrufenden Programm gespeichert ist.


Im QC2 funktioniert das aber nicht so, kann die Datei nicht finden.


 

bei Antwort benachrichtigen
Nobody666 Nachtrag zu: „Hilfe bei QC2 - C-Compiler“
Optionen

also, speichere den Pfad zuerst in einer Variablen:
if ((param=fopen(File_name,"r"))==NULL) {
fprintf(fp,"T05:Die Datei %s wurde nicht gefunden!\n)
exit(0);
if(fscanf(ep,"%s",bin)==NULL) //hier lese ich Datei ein, die ich später
// öffnen will
exit(0);
strcpy(f_Datei,bin); //speichern des Namen in der Variable f_Datei
......etwas später....
if ( (werte = fopen(f_Datei,"rb"))==NULL) {.....

hier findet er jetzt die Datei nicht. Wenn ich statt den Variablennamen, den kompletten Pfad eingebe (z.B. D:\\test\\abc.dat) dann öffnet er sie mir, so aber nicht!!!!
HILFE!!

bei Antwort benachrichtigen